The Scenic Journey Begins: Chochołów

Kraków to Zakopane Private Luxury Tour - The Scenic Journey Begins: Chochołów

Our day starts with a visit to Chochołów, a picture-perfect village where traditional highlander wooden architecture remains remarkably well-preserved. Walking through the narrow streets, you’ll notice intricate carvings on the houses and vibrant flower-filled gardens. It’s a lively reminder of the region’s folk traditions and historical resilience, as Chochołów played a role in the January Uprising of 1863.

Traveling here, we appreciate how the village feels like stepping into a living postcard. It’s an ideal spot to understand what makes highlander culture distinct—simple, charming, and rooted in tradition. The 30-minute stop allows plenty of time to admire the architecture and snap photos, with no admission fee to distract from the scenic views.

Tasting the Tatra’s Treasure: Oscypek

Next, we stop at a Bacówka, a mountain farmstead where the highlight is sampling Oscypek, a smoked cheese crafted from sheep’s milk. This cheese is a regional specialty, shaped into decorative patterns and flavored with a salty, smoky taste that pairs beautifully with cranberry jam. Our guide explains how highlanders have perfected cheese-making over centuries using traditional methods.

This 30-minute tasting offers more than just a snack; it’s an opportunity to appreciate local culinary craftsmanship. The cheese’s firm texture and unique flavor make it a must-try for foodies. Plus, tasting regional produce like Oscypek deepens the cultural connection, making the experience more authentic.

A Well-Deserved Relaxation at Chochoowskie Termy

After a full day of sightseeing, the tour concludes with a three-hour visit to Chochoowskie Termy, a thermal spa set amidst mountain scenery. The indoor and outdoor pools filled with naturally warm mineral waters are perfect for unwinding tired muscles. The spa offers saunas, wellness treatments, and massage options, making it an ideal way to relax after hiking or exploring.

The setting amidst the mountains makes the experience feel serene and rejuvenating. Whether you prefer soaking in outdoor pools with mountain views or enjoying a sauna session, this part of the tour provides genuine relaxation that many travelers find worthwhile.
